Abstrak
Tropical peatlands play an important role in the global carbon pool as they form one of the terrestrial ecosystems with the highest carbon density. Peat
accumulation leads to the formation of peat domes that store ombrotrophic water and are characterised by increasing nutrient availability and waterlogging
from the top to the lower riverine areas of the domes. Peat domes are naturally covered with peat swamp forests PSF that show compositional and structural
transitions along the nutrient and waterlogging gradients. Little is known about the functional ecology of peat swamp forests along undisturbed peat domes and
under diferent disturbance regimes of drainage and ire. This study proposes to analyse temporal and spatial changes of PSF composition and structure in
pristine and degraded PSF by combining a ield and remote sensing approach. LIDAR LIght Detection And Ranging is a state-of-the-art tool to monitor 3D
forest structure and spatial organisation in inaccessible forests at a broad scale, but this technique needs to be ground-truthed. The project will be carried out in
the BOS Borneo Orangutan Survival Mawas Conservation area in collaboration with KFCP Kalimantan Forests and Climate Partnership and results will improve
our knowledge on PSF ecology and recovery dynamics and will be valuable to local conservation and restoration initiatives.

Abstrak
An international team of researchers and students from Indonesia and the USA, including, Brawijaya University, the Bogor MuseumIndonesian Institute of
Sciences, Broward College, and the University of Texas at Arlington, will ill in a massive gap in global biodiversity awareness through a large scale inventory
of reptiles snakes, lizards, crocodiles and turtles and amphibians frogs and caecilians from the Javan and Sumatran montane forests of Indonesia. As of today,
these tropical montane highlands are poorly sampled. Previous work suggests that these areas are the most species rich on earth megadiverse, and contain
vast numbers of endemic species with restricted ranges. These species represent the largest number of vertebrate animals yet to be discovered and described by
scientists.
Only a handful of researchers specialized in reptiles and amphibians currently work in Indonesia, an archipelagic country the size of the continental USA and
with more than 17,000 islands. The survey will likely discover hundreds of new species from this poorly known area of the world and will result in educational
and research partnerships between Indonesia and the USA. As a beneit to the scientiic community, the project will produce modern specimen repositories in
the two participating countries and web-based resources for identiication and conservation, and for genetic and biodiversity work.
